Support staff should consult these notes before filing a relevance bug — many "wrong results" reports trace back to an intentional weight change documented there. When a customer complaint can't be explained by the notes, gather the query string, locale, and result screenshot, then open a ticket. For urgent ranking regressions affecting the Bramblepoint tenant, reach the search team directly.

escalation mailbox, bafog-fafog: ulador@paliqlabs.internal

**Ticket GATE-412: Turnstile counter vault locked**

Hey reviewer — before you approve the Clickthrough counter refactor for Ember Field Stadium, heads-up that the config vault storing the gate-calibration secrets locked itself after the migration script retried too many times. The turnstile counts are still flowing, but we can't rotate the per-gate tokens until it's open. The unlock flow is the usual two-step: run the unseal command from the bastion, then supply the recovery passphrase below when prompted.

unlock words, kagef-taduf: fenir-quenix-norwyn-sorvan-gormir-gorir-fraok

Markdown pipeline runbook — Ferngate renderer. If preview output is blank, check the Slateroot sanitizer stage first; it silently drops documents over 2MB. Restart the worker pool, then replay the failed queue from the Mirrowell dashboard. Do not clear the cache unless rendering errors persist after replay. Escalate to the Ferngate on-call if replay loops twice. Verification requires the trace token from the last successful replay, shown below.

trace token, yahif-kagep: htk31_bd0cc6b1d7ab4f7094c586a5de900e0

Exec team: the Morrow Fabrication supply contract renews next month. Finance recommends a two-year term with the revised volume discount. Legal has cleared the draft. Decision needed by Friday; delay risks reverting to list pricing. Costs are within budget. The confidential strategic context is set out below.

management briefing: Project Ulavan slips by two quarters because of the staffing delay.